OverviewFrom the silent films of Charlie Chaplin to today's high-tech blockbusters, this well-illustrated and insightful volume chronicles movie favorites from all genres and time periods. Organized by era, the first part of this guide delves into genres such as romance, comedy, action, sci-fi, cult favorites, and musicals and introduces key players behind the camera as well as spotlighting movie stars with superb portraits. This detailed reference also explores historical and contemporary dynamics within the movie industry, such as the thriving Hollywood studios of the 1930s and 1940s, the Bollywood phenomenon, and the influence of international filmmakers. The second part then lists a selection of 130 movies not to be missed, containing everything from beloved classics to eclectic examples of groundbreaking movie-making technology. Included throughout are reproductions of movie posters, movie stills, and other colorful graphics that will provide movie lovers with hours of enjoyment. Language: Spanish Table of ContentsReviewsAuthor InformationPaolo d'Agostini is a journalist and a film critic who has served on the screening committee for the Venice Film Festival. Franco Zeffirelli is an acclaimed film and opera director, a designer, a producer, and a member of the Italian senate. His film version of Shakespeare's Romeo and Juliet was nominated for an Academy Award, and his TV mini-series Jesus of Nazareth is televised worldwide during Easter. He was awarded an honorary knighthood by the United Kingdom. Tab Content 6Author Website:Countries AvailableAll regions |
